Abstract

A novel electrically small compact meander line antenna is reported. The antenna consists of a meander line which acts as a capacitively loaded patch with complementary split ring resonators (CSRRs) cell etched on the ground plane. The antenna has shown significantly size reduction in comparison to a conventional microstrip patch antennas. The antenna was designed to work at 1.73 GHz and fabricated on Roger/RO3010 substrate. The antenna has a very compact size of the patch at 16.4×16.4 mm2, being less than 74% of the size of conventional patch antenna.
